Embodiment 1
[0027] Carry out the preparation of protein glycoside polymerization agent:
[0028] 1) Crush 95.1kg of dried licorice rhizome for use, and mix with 4500 kiwi fruit, 200 95% ethanol, 210 protein additives;
[0029] 2) Soak the mixture obtained in step 1 at a constant temperature of 35°C for 23 hours. After soaking, pulp and filter to get the slurry for later use;
[0030] 3) In the slurry obtained in step 2, add activated carbon with a weight ratio of 1% of the slurry, and heat the slurry with activated carbon to 60°C, and then keep it warm for 38 minutes;
[0031] 4) filtering the slurry obtained in step 3, and concentrating the slurry under reduced pressure until crystallized;
[0032] 5) Stir the crystals obtained in step 4 to complete the precipitation of the crystals, filter and take the crystals, and place the crystals in a vacuum environment at 60°C for drying.

Embodiment 3
[0041] Carry out the preparation of protein glycoside polymerization agent:
[0042] 1) Crush 100kg of dry rhizome of licorice for use, and mix it with 5000g of macaque fruit, 250g of 95% ethanol, and 250g of protein additives;
[0043] 2) Soak the mixture obtained in step 1 at a constant temperature of 35°C for 25 hours. After soaking, pulp and filter to get the slurry for later use;
[0044] 3) In the slurry obtained in step 2, add activated carbon with a weight ratio of 1% of the slurry, and heat the slurry with activated carbon to 60°C, and then keep it warm for 40 minutes;
[0045] 4) filtering the slurry obtained in step 3, and concentrating the slurry under reduced pressure until crystallized;
[0046] 5) Stir the crystals obtained in step 4 to complete the precipitation of the crystals, filter and take the crystals, and place the crystals in a vacuum environment at 60°C for drying.
